.. _class_Vector4_method_cubic_interpolate:
- :ref:`Vector4<class_Vector4>` **cubic_interpolate** **(** :ref:`Vector4<class_Vector4>` b, :ref:`Vector4<class_Vector4>` pre_a, :ref:`Vector4<class_Vector4>` post_b, :ref:`float<class_float>` weight **)** |const|
Performs a cubic interpolation between this vector and ``b`` using ``pre_a`` and ``post_b`` as handles, and returns the result at position ``weight``. ``weight`` is on the range of 0.0 to 1.0, representing the amount of interpolation.
----
.. _class_Vector4_method_cubic_interpolate_in_time:
- :ref:`Vector4<class_Vector4>` **cubic_interpolate_in_time** **(** :ref:`Vector4<class_Vector4>` b, :ref:`Vector4<class_Vector4>` pre_a, :ref:`Vector4<class_Vector4>` post_b, :ref:`float<class_float>` weight, :ref:`float<class_float>` b_t, :ref:`float<class_float>` pre_a_t, :ref:`float<class_float>` post_b_t **)** |const|
Performs a cubic interpolation between this vector and ``b`` using ``pre_a`` and ``post_b`` as handles, and returns the result at position ``weight``. ``weight`` is on the range of 0.0 to 1.0, representing the amount of interpolation.
It can perform smoother interpolation than ``cubic_interpolate()`` by the time values.
----
.. _class_Vector4_method_direction_to:
- :ref:`Vector4<class_Vector4>` **direction_to** **(** :ref:`Vector4<class_Vector4>` to **)** |const|
Returns the normalized vector pointing from this vector to ``to``. This is equivalent to using ``(b - a).normalized()``.
----
.. _class_Vector4_method_distance_squared_to:
- :ref:`float<class_float>` **distance_squared_to** **(** :ref:`Vector4<class_Vector4>` to **)** |const|
Returns the squared distance between this vector and ``to``.
This method runs faster than :ref:`distance_to<class_Vector4_method_distance_to>`, so prefer it if you need to compare vectors or need the squared distance for some formula.
----
.. _class_Vector4_method_distance_to:
- :ref:`float<class_float>` **distance_to** **(** :ref:`Vector4<class_Vector4>` to **)** |const|
Returns the distance between this vector and ``to``.

.. _class_Vector4_method_posmod:
- :ref:`Vector4<class_Vector4>` **posmod** **(** :ref:`float<class_float>` mod **)** |const|
Returns a vector composed of the :ref:`@GlobalScope.fposmod<class_@GlobalScope_method_fposmod>` of this vector's components and ``mod``.
----
.. _class_Vector4_method_posmodv:
- :ref:`Vector4<class_Vector4>` **posmodv** **(** :ref:`Vector4<class_Vector4>` modv **)** |const|
Returns a vector composed of the :ref:`@GlobalScope.fposmod<class_@GlobalScope_method_fposmod>` of this vector's components and ``modv``'s components.

.. _class_Vector4_method_snapped:
- :ref:`Vector4<class_Vector4>` **snapped** **(** :ref:`Vector4<class_Vector4>` step **)** |const|
Returns this vector with each component snapped to the nearest multiple of ``step``. This can also be used to round to an arbitrary number of decimals.
